Méthode CHString ::Mid(int) (chstring.h)

[La classe CHString fait partie de l’infrastructure du fournisseur WMI, qui est maintenant considérée dans l’état final, et aucun développement, amélioration ou mise à jour supplémentaire ne sera disponible pour les problèmes non liés à la sécurité affectant ces bibliothèques. Les API MI doivent être utilisées pour tout nouveau développement.]

La méthode Mid extrait une sous-chaîne de longueur nCount caractères à partir d’une chaîne CHString , en commençant à la position nFirst (base zéro). La méthode retourne une copie de la sous-chaîne extraite.

Syntaxe

CHString  throw(CHeap_Exception) Mid(
  int nFirst
);

Paramètres

nFirst

Index de base zéro du premier caractère de cette chaîne CHString qui est inclus dans la sous-chaîne extraite.

Valeur retournée

Renvoie un objet CHString qui contient une copie de la plage de caractères spécifiée. L’objet CHString retourné peut être vide.

Remarques

La méthode Mid est similaire à la fonction MID$ de base, sauf que dans la fonction MID$ de base, les index sont de base zéro.

Exemples

L’exemple de code suivant montre l’utilisation de CHString ::Mid.

CHString s( L"abcdef" );
assert( s.Mid( 2, 3 ) == L"cde" );

Configuration requise

Condition requise Valeur
Client minimal pris en charge Windows Vista
Serveur minimal pris en charge Windows Server 2008
Plateforme cible Windows
En-tête chstring.h (inclure FwCommon.h)
Bibliothèque FrameDyn.lib
DLL FrameDynOS.dll ; FrameDyn.dll

Voir aussi

CHString

CHString ::Left

CHString ::Right